JFFS2 filesystem producing - jffs2_read_inode() on nonexistent ino xx
 
Hello -

I have an arm7 sbc, and since we deployed it, an error has been popping up at various customer locations. After writing to the filesystem and then doing an ls -al the error:

jffs2_read_inode() on nonexistent ino xx

is generated.

Can anyone assist in pointing me in the right direction to
1) try to get a reproducible case
2) what could possibly be causing this problem. I have read through the jffs2 code, and nothing jumps out at me.

The filesystems may be corrupted if the board is not properly shutdown.
If this happens even without restarting the board, then there may be another problem.
